Govind Rajan, Chief Executive of payments Wallet Freecharge has quit the company as its parent Snapdeal is struggling to shed the business within two years of its acquisition, at a time when India’s digital payments ecosystem is growing. Snapdeal has been struggling to raise fresh funds to sustain the business in the long run. “It has been a unique privilege to helm FreeCharge in these exciting times of rapid growth. I am confident that FreeCharge will achieve still greater heights under its incredibly talented team,” said Rajan.
